Nollywood Actress Iyabo Ojo Shows Support for Socialite Farida Sobowale After Suicide Attempt

By Daniel Edu

Nigerian actress Iyabo Ojo has expressed her support for Lagos socialite Farida Sobowale, CEO of House of Phreeda, following her recent suicide attempt. It was reported that Farida had tried to jump off the Third Mainland bridge in Lagos but was thankfully rescued by passersby.

Iyabo Ojo, who is close to Farida, shared her feelings on the situation in an Instagram post. She revealed that she had just been on the phone with Farida and wouldn’t have hung up if she had known about her thoughts. Iyabo Ojo explained how Farida had already planned her actions but diverted her attention during their call. She thanked the people who intervened and saved Farida’s life, reassuring her that things would get better and that she was loved and supported.

Actress Nkechi Blessing also showed her concern and empathy for Farida in a separate Instagram post. She highlighted the impact of online trolling and bullying, and she urged Farida’s friends and family to provide her with unwavering support during this challenging time.

Rumors suggest that Farida’s marriage might be facing difficulties, contributing to her emotional state. Reportedly, her husband has allegedly been speaking negatively about her to others, which has caused distress and mental anguish for Farida.

Both Iyabo Ojo and Nkechi Blessing’s messages of support emphasize the importance of community and assistance during tough times, particularly in the face of online harassment and personal struggles.
